Lions got called for a hands to the face penalty committed by the Bears

Jeff Triplette threw a flag on the wrong dang team.

Detroit Lions head coach Jim Caldwell chewed out referee Jeff Triplette’s staff after an illegal hands to the face penalty moved Detroit back 10 yards. It turns out Caldwell had a pretty good case.

Replays showed there was an illegal move during the play in question, but it turns out it was Chicago Bears defensive lineman Eddie Goldman using a Detroit lineman’s facemask as leverage to get into the backfield. Instead of calling the foul on Chicago, Triplette flagged the Lions, turning a 14-yard gain into a 10-yard loss for Caldwell’s team.

Former offensive lineman LeCharles Bentley took to Twitter to showcase just how impressively incorrect Triplette’s call was.

The horrible call didn’t have a major affect on the Lions’ drive. Stafford hit Marvin Jones for a 48-yard gain two plays later, setting up a 29-yard field goal to tie the game at 3-3 in the second quarter.
